Alibaba Quick BI is a business intelligence platform developed by Alibaba Cloud. It enables enterprises and individual users to build comprehensive data analysis systems. The platform offers a wide range of data analysis and visualization capabilities, along with support for OLAP modeling and semantic data types such as dimensions and measures. Quick BI facilitates the creation of dashboards and allows users to generate them using natural language.
Quick BI supports integration with multiple data sources, providing robust computing performance for multi-dimensional analysis. It allows for the conversion of data sources into multi-dimensional analytics models, which is essential for big data scenarios and data analysis across various platforms.
The platform is designed for both data visualization and modeling. Users can define calculated fields and embed dashboards into third-party systems, ensuring full control over data access permissions. This makes it suitable for creating a BI platform quickly and at a low cost.

Alibaba Quick BI is a cloud-based business intelligence (BI) service from Alibaba Cloud. It facilitates data analysis and visualization for enterprises and individual users, enabling the construction of data analysis systems. Quick BI supports various data sources, including ApsaraDB for RDS, AnalyticDB, MaxCompute, MySQL, SQL Server, and local files. It offers capabilities such as dashboard and spreadsheet creation, data downloading, report integration, and sharing via multiple platforms.
Quick BI excels in integrating data across multiple platforms, providing robust computing performance for multi-dimensional analysis and data modeling. It allows for seamless data integration with cloud data, ensuring that users can connect to and analyze a wide array of data sources efficiently.
With its powerful data visualization tools, Quick BI supports a variety of chart types and the ability to embed dashboards into third-party systems. Users can perform in-depth data analysis, utilize row and column filters, and set individual row access permissions to tailor data visibility across different user roles.
